Ninja Museum of Igaryu

“Are they friend of foe?”
Iga-city, the birthplace of Ninja, has a museum of all about Ninja. To reach the secret of Ninja, going over the unpaved steep path is necessary, therefore, visit with tough companions is recommended for wheelchair users. In the Ninja House, listen carefully to the Kuno-ichi (female Ninja) guide and be careful not to hit the traps hidden within the house. Ninja trick performance is also available for a fee. Most of its attractions are accessible for wheelchair users. Explore the unknown world of Ninja. Don’t forget to pick up the original Ninja souvenirs sold only at the Museum Shop!
